Ingredients
- 2 cups catsup
- 1 cup brown sugar, packed
- 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
- 2 tablespoons cider vinegar
- salt
- pepper
- 6 lbs chicken wings
Preparation
Step 1
In a medium bowl, whisk together catsup, sugar, Worcestershire, and vinegar; season with salt and pepper. Set aside 1 cup sauce for tossing raw chicken; use rest for baked chicken.
Preheat oven to 450 degrees, with racks in upper and lower thirds; line two rimmed baking sheets with aluminum foil.
Divide wings between baking sheets, and toss with reserved 1 cup sauce.
Bake chicken until opaque throughout, 30 to 35 minutes, rotating sheets and tossing chicken halfway through. Toss baked wings with 1/2 cup sauce, and serve with remaining sauce on the side.
